SGHS Gaming Clubs Hosts First Smashgiving Event

This year, the SGHS Gaming Club held its first annual Smashgiving event, a fundraising effort where student gamers competed in a Super Smash Bros tournament. The event was held on Nov. 23, and club members could enter the tournament through bringing in a donation to local families during Thanksgiving. 

Prizes for this year’s Smashgiving were donated and provided by Iggy’s Pop Shop, a local gaming and retail shop in Ste. Genevieve.
